317 East 18th Street, Eastville Gardens Cooperative, is a pre-war boutique co-op located in the heart of the Gramercy Park. This 6 story, 28 apartment elevator building with live-in super and central laundry offers tranquil, quiet resident living while having all the energy of Gramercy Park right outside your door. Dream location, one is close to all the hip restaurants, coffee shops and bars; including Gramercy Tavern, ABC, Sugarfish, and Dear Irving. Also, just a block away from Stuyvesant Square Park and short walk to Union Square with Whole Foods and Trader Joe's! Easy to commute around, one is near the 4/5/6/N/Q/R/L subway lines.
